5.5 Mathematics
Computation of Factor for
PT calibration curve:
Determine the 100 % value in s (e.g.12.2 sec) and the 25 % value in sec
(e.g.29.3 sec) from regular plasma in double determination and proceed as
follows:
Computation of Factor:
(25 % Value in sec) – (100 % Value in sec)
(1/25) – (1/100 %) = factor
Example:
( 29.3 – 12.2 )
17.1
(1/25) – (1/100 %)
= 0.04-0.01 = factor = 570
Please only enter the first two digits into the menu, as for example 57!

Computation of mean
If in a dual determination the individual results deviate to a larger extent
than permitted by the coefficient of variation, the error message mean error
will be displayed and printed-out.
Extrapolation
PT >100 % linear extrapolation over the last two higher points.
PT <10 % linear extrapolation over the last two lower points.
Fibrinogen: linear extrapolation respectively over the last two points.
